Output 6326321a36d7a1ff56955b9bc1a12a9e366e5d4ce92c1d111b352ca2da36f0de:23

value
14655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cbae98cef1f68e363036a4c317f3e40ae50adde OP_EQUAL
address
3A9L15zarNjtcCxi1DyMPweXaSnkfqj15W
transaction
6326321a36d7a1ff56955b9bc1a12a9e366e5d4ce92c1d111b352ca2da36f0de
confirmations
531437
spent
true